Microsoft's ChatGPT-Powered Bing: Waitlist Hits 1 Million in Just 48 Hours!

The buzz is real! Microsoft announced the new Bing this week, which features ChatGPT and AI technology, and the response has been overwhelming. Over 1 million people signed up to try the new search engine within 48 hours. More than one million people are now using Microsoft’s new ChatGPT-powered Bing search engine as part of an early preview of the new software, the tech giant has revealed.

You might already know the reason for this sudden interest: The new Bing has AI! Over a million people requested early access to Bing’s ChatGPT-powered search. This surge in demand highlights the excitement surrounding Microsoft's integration of cutting-edge AI into its search engine.
